我正在尝试使用PHP和Windows身份验证连接到我的SQL
服务器,但一直得到HTTP 500 Internal Server Error
。我仔细检查了代码,并认为它是正确的。问题可能在哪里?我在某处读到此错误,可能是由于权限不足,但我是管理员。
我可以加载PHP
网页,因此我知道PHP
的设置正确。
我尝试使用SQL
身份验证,但遇到相同的错误。
<?php
$serverName = "(soaksql1)";
$connectionInfo = array( "Database"=>"PHP_Test");
$conn = sqlsrv_connect( $serverName, $connectionInfo);
if( $conn ) {
echo "Connection established.<br />";
}else{
echo "Connection could not be established.<br />";
die( print_r( sqlsrv_errors(), true));
}
?>
我想使连接正常工作,以便可以写入SQL
表。
此错误(HTTP 500
Internal Server Error
)表示您正在访问的网站存在服务器问题,导致该网页无法显示。